(Greendale, Ind.) - A community shred day will be held this Saturday in Greendale.
The City of Greendale and Greendale Main Street will host the event at the Greendale Utility building at 510 Ridge Avenue from 8:30 to 11:30 a.m.
Greendale residents and all of Dearborn County are invited to have their documents securely shredded.
A professional shredding company will be on site and participants can watch as they safely and securely shred your documents.
The event is free to participate in.
